- The distance between Marshall, Tx, Usa and Aragarcas, Brazil is approximately 7,006 km or 4,354 mi.
- To reach Marshall, Tx in this distance one would set out from Aragarcas bearing 320.6°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Marshall, Tx bearing 313.6° or NW .
- Marshall, Tx has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Aragarcas has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Marshall, Tx is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Aragarcas is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The average temperature is 7.3 °C (13.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.5 °C (29.7°F) more in Marshall, Tx.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 364.8 mm (14.4 in) less which is equivalent to 364.8 l/m² (8.95 US gal/ft²) or 3,648,000 l/ha (389,995 US gal/ac) less. About 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.1° lower in Marshall, Tx than in Aragarcas.
